    Dude...great pics and that place looks like a slice of heaven! My wife and I live in El Paso, TX, but we have a cabin up in the mountains of New Mexico (Cloudcroft). I haven't had the ATV's up there yet, but plan to soon. Can't wait. Do you run into any jetting issues when you get that high up? El Paso is around 4,700 ft. and Cloudcroft is 9,000+ ft. I'm just worried I'll have issues....

    Quote Originally Posted by 350Kris View Post
    Dude...great pics and that place looks like a slice of heaven! My wife and I live in El Paso, TX, but we have a cabin up in the mountains of New Mexico (Cloudcroft). I haven't had the ATV's up there yet, but plan to soon. Can't wait. Do you run into any jetting issues when you get that high up? El Paso is around 4,700 ft. and Cloudcroft is 9,000+ ft. I'm just worried I'll have issues....

    I did have to take the airbox lid off the 350x that has the 6 pack rack, it was running rich and bogging in the midrange, it's jetted a lil' fat anyways and I ride it at sea level mostly.

    The other 350x is a lil' hotter hp wise, but I think the more open exhaust helps a ton, no problems at all with the altitude change on that one.
